During a vulnerability scan, an analyst discovers a high-severity vulnerability on a critical database server. The server is in production and cannot be taken offline. The vendor has released a patch but requires a reboot. Which of the following should the analyst recommend FIRST?
⚠ Common exam trap
CompTIA often tests the candidate's ability to prioritize business continuity over immediate remediation, leading candidates to incorrectly choose 'Apply the patch immediately' (Option C) because they focus solely on the high severity without considering the operational impact of a reboot on a critical production server.

Schedule the patch during the next maintenance window.
The database server is in production and cannot be taken offline, so the patch must be applied during a scheduled maintenance window to minimize business disruption. The vulnerability is high-severity, but the vendor requires a reboot, which would cause downtime; therefore, the first step is to plan the patch application at the next available maintenance window, not to apply it immediately or implement a workaround that may not fully mitigate the risk.

- ✗
Implement a workaround from the vendor.
Why it's wrong here
Implementing a workaround from the vendor, while offering temporary relief, is not the optimal first response for a high-severity vulnerability when a definitive patch is available. Workarounds often introduce additional operational complexity, may not fully mitigate the underlying risk, and still require the eventual application of the permanent fix. This approach is typically reserved for situations where a patch is not yet released or cannot be applied within a reasonable timeframe, rather than as a primary remediation step.
- ✓
Schedule the patch during the next maintenance window.
Why this is correct
Scheduling the patch during the next maintenance window represents the best practice for addressing high-severity vulnerabilities in production environments. This approach allows for proper change management, including testing the patch in a non-production environment, planning for potential rollbacks, and communicating downtime to stakeholders. It effectively balances the need for security remediation with the critical requirement for system availability and operational stability, minimizing unplanned service disruptions.
- ✗
Apply the patch immediately.
Why it's wrong here
Applying the patch immediately, without proper planning or adherence to change management protocols, carries significant risks that can outweigh the benefits of rapid remediation. Unscheduled patching bypasses crucial steps like impact analysis, compatibility testing, and stakeholder notification, potentially leading to unforeseen system instability, application failures, or unplanned downtime. Such impulsive actions can introduce new vulnerabilities or operational issues, making the situation worse than waiting for a controlled deployment.
- ✗
Migrate the database to a new server.
Why it's wrong here
Migrating the database to a new server is an extreme and disproportionate response to a discovered high-severity vulnerability that can likely be addressed with a patch. Database migration is a complex, resource-intensive project requiring extensive planning, testing, and significant downtime, typically reserved for hardware end-of-life, major architectural changes, or unpatchable critical vulnerabilities. It is not a standard or efficient first step for remediating a patchable security flaw identified during a routine scan.

Risk
Risk is the possibility that an event or action will negatively affect an organization's ability to achieve its goals, often measured in terms of likelihood and impact.

Vulnerability
A vulnerability is a weakness in a system, network, or software that could be exploited by a threat to cause harm or unauthorized access.
